IRISH-trained horses won 17 of the 28 races run at the Cheltenham Festival last year. In 2017, they won 19. In 2016, they won 15. So in each of the last three years, there have been more Irish-trained Cheltenham Festival winners than British-trained Cheltenham Festival winners. So you can understand why the market is skewed in favour of Irish-trained horses again this year.

But the market may be skewed too much.
